RISC-V Foundational Associate (RVFA) Practice Exam

RISC-V Foundational Associate (RVFA) Practice Exam

RISC-V Foundational Associate (RVFA) Practice Exam

The RISC-V Foundational Associate (RVFA) certification is an entry-level certification that introduces learners to the RISC-V architecture—an open-standard instruction set used in processors around the world. Unlike proprietary processor architectures, RISC-V is open source, meaning it can be freely used and adapted, which makes it increasingly popular in industries ranging from consumer electronics to advanced computing. RVFA certification helps individuals understand the basics of RISC-V design, operation, and its role in modern computing systems.

This certification is designed for beginners and professionals who want to build their careers in computer architecture, embedded systems, or hardware design. It provides foundational knowledge about how processors work, instruction sets, and the importance of open standards in technology. With the rising adoption of RISC-V across industries, RVFA serves as a strong starting point for those aiming to take advanced specializations in hardware engineering, chip design, or software optimization.

Who should take the Exam?

This exam is ideal for:

  • Students in Computer Science or Electronics
  • Junior Hardware/Embedded Engineers
  • Software Developers working on low-level systems
  • Technical Support Specialists in hardware companies
  • Research Assistants in computer architecture
  • IoT and robotics enthusiasts

Skills Required

  • Basic understanding of computers and programming
  • Interest in hardware and processor technologies
  • Logical and analytical thinking
  • Curiosity about embedded systems and chip design
  • Problem-solving skills

Knowledge Gained

  • Fundamentals of RISC-V architecture
  • Basics of instruction sets and processor design
  • Understanding hardware-software interaction
  • Concepts of embedded systems and computing efficiency
  • Awareness of open-source hardware movement

Course Outline

The RISC-V Foundational Associate (RVFA) Exam covers the following topics - 

  • Domain 1 - RISC‑V Overview (10%)
  • History of RISC‑V: The Free and Open ISA
  • RISC‑V International
  • RISC‑V Documentation
  • Contribute to RISC‑V 

Domain 2 - RISC‑V Instruction Set Architecture (35%)

  • RV32I and RV64I
  • Understand Instruction Formats: branching, accessing memory, and accessing data structures
  • Understand the modularity of RISC‑V as an ISA: core ratified (M, C, F, D, A) and other extensions
  • Understand Privilege Modes, system calls, CSRs, exceptions, and interrupt handling
  • Understand memory model, cache management, and virtual memory management 

Domain 3 - Assembly Language for RISC‑V (25%)

  • Understand RISC‑V specific assembly language syntax and features, including CSR access
  • Write and debug RISC‑V assembly code
  • Assess performance of assembly code

Domain 4 - High Level Languages for RISC‑V: C Programming (15%)

  • Understand RISC‑V tools including compilers, debuggers, simulators, performance tools, OSes, and SDKs
  • Understand calling conventions (ABIs), the stack, and disassembly

Domain 5 - RISC‑V Operating Systems & Tools (15%)

  • Fundamentals of Operating Systems including implementing basic OS functionality in RISC‑V ASM
  • Understanding basic use and functionality of firmware for RISC‑V platforms
  • Understanding microcontrollers versus application processors
  • Running RISC‑V Applications in a General Purpose OS
     

Reviews

No reviews yet. Be the first to review!

Write a review

Note: HTML is not translated!
Bad           Good

Tags: RISC-V Foundational Associate (RVFA) Online Test, RISC-V Foundational Associate (RVFA) MCQ, RISC-V Foundational Associate (RVFA) Certificate, RISC-V Foundational Associate (RVFA) Certification Exam, RISC-V Foundational Associate (RVFA) Practice Questions, RISC-V Foundational Associate (RVFA) Practice Test, RISC-V Foundational Associate (RVFA) Sample Questions, RISC-V Foundational Associate (RVFA) Practice Exam,